2022 RAV4 Colors

2022 Toyota RAV4 Cavalry Blue profile viewCavalry Blue will be offered as a color choice in a few different 2022 Toyota RAV4 and Toyota RAV4 Hybrid trim levels.

The most striking RAV4 trim to carry Cavalry Blue is RAV4 XSE Hybrid. I think this will be really cool mixed in with gloss black accents like the roof and the wheels.

RAV4 TRD Off-Road will also offer Cavalry Blue for 2022.

Magnus (not verified)    November 10, 2021 - 5:54AM

Confirmed European Rav4 2022 updates:

- New LED headlight design
- New 10 spoke rim design
- New LED foglights
- New interior LED lights
- Electrical adjustable passenger seat
- New USB-C ports
- illuminated window switches
- New available seat trim colors
